Output e21ba94ca9cf4aed062eb5b3598769b43bf681d6d651da1cd3c02feb5b80bf5c:1

value
3064923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b4ddab9a1a200c28b225d1ab5aa7ba00c10c695 OP_EQUAL
address
3CvzJZGKRJth93xXMuCGsPVoaervk16r8n
transaction
e21ba94ca9cf4aed062eb5b3598769b43bf681d6d651da1cd3c02feb5b80bf5c